GHSA-g56w-cwg4-hxx9 — quarkus-vertx-http-deploy…
CRITICALGHSA-g56w-cwg4-hxx9 is a critical-severity (CVSS 9.8) remote code execution vulnerability in io.quarkus:quarkus-vertx-http-deployment. EPSS puts its 30-day exploitation probability at 32.5% (98th percentile). A fix is available for io.quarkus:quarkus-vertx-http-deployment — see the affected versions and patch details below.
Code injection in quarkus dev ui config editor

Description
A vulnerability was found in quarkus. This security flaw happens in Dev UI Config Editor which is vulnerable to drive-by localhost attacks leading to remote code execution.
Affected Packages
| Ecosystem | Package | Vulnerable range | Fix |
|---|---|---|---|
| ☕Maven | io.quarkus:quarkus-vertx-http-deployment | ≥ 2.14.0&&< 2.14.2.Final | 2.14.2.Finalio.quarkus:quarkus-vertx-http-deployment:2.14.2.Final |
| ☕Maven | io.quarkus:quarkus-vertx-http-deployment | all versions | 2.13.5.Finalio.quarkus:quarkus-vertx-http-deployment:2.13.5.Final |

Fixing This On Your OS
If you run this on a Linux distribution, patch through your package manager against the distro's own security advisory below — it tracks the exact backported fix for your release, which can ship on a different timeline (and sometimes a different severity) than the upstream project.
| Product | Fixed in | Advisory |
|---|---|---|
| Red Hat build of Quarkus 2.13.5 | see advisory | RHSA-2022:9023 |
| Red Hat build of Quarkus Platform 2.7.6.SP3 | quarkus_dev_ui | RHSA-2022:8957 |
